New York City offers a unique blend of urban luxury and golf accessibility for travelers. While Manhattan may not have sprawling fairways, several top-tier hotels provide golf packages that include access to premier courses in the region or private club arrangements. These hotels, like the Mandarin Oriental, New York with its Central Park views and 75-foot indoor pool, or the Park Hyatt New York near Carnegie Hall, cater to visitors who want to combine business, sightseeing, and tee times without sacrificing comfort. Guests typically budget between $400 and $800 per night for these accommodations, which often include perks like private parking, fitness centers, and on-site dining. The most golf-friendly options cluster around Midtown Manhattan, especially near Columbus Circle, Grand Central Terminal, and the Theater District, ensuring easy access to both the links and iconic landmarks such as the Empire State Building and Times Square.
For those seeking a more boutique experience, properties like The Chatwal, The Unbound Collection by Hyatt in the Theater District offer personal butler service and 400-thread-count linens alongside golf packages, while the Kimpton Hotel Eventi in Chelsea provides a complimentary evening wine hour and 24-hour fitness centers. The Westin New York Grand Central, a 2-minute walk from the Chrysler Building, features a grab-and-go breakfast and business-friendly amenities. Travelers should note that these packages typically require advance booking and may include transportation to courses outside the city. For a truly lavish stay, The Mark New York, just one block from Central Park, combines golf packages with the Mark Restaurant by Jean Georges and a state-of-the-art gym, making it ideal for families or couples who value both relaxation and recreation.
